WATERLOO, Ontario, April 30, 2019 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Descartes Systems Group (Nasdaq:DSGX) (TSX:DSG), the global leader in uniting logistics-intensive businesses in commerce, announced that New York-based aircitypost, a leading ecommerce express shipping provider, is leveraging the Descartes Air Automated Manifest System (Air AMS) solution to comply with U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) rules that allow for the express customs clearance and release of ecommerce air cargo shipments valued at US$800 or less.

“With the explosion of international ecommerce, aircitypost’s shipment volumes have more than tripled in the last year alone,” said Frank Casano, CEO at aircitypost. “We’ve been using Descartes Air AMS for 10+ years to facilitate customs filings for air cargo. Descartes helped us scale our business and completely automate filing for lower-value ecommerce shipments. Using the Descartes Air AMS solution, we’re helping an average of one to two million ecommerce shipments per month get to their destination faster without increasing costs.”

aircitypost has used Descartes Air AMS for over a decade to speed the flow of import cargo into the U.S. and comply with requirements to electronically file air waybill information with CBP for customs clearance. For ecommerce packages where the total value does not exceed US$800, aircitypost uses the section 321 entry in the Descartes solution to automatically file basic shipment details at the air manifest level with CBP, instead of a more formal customs entry. This allows CBP to expedite customs clearance and permits shipments to be delivered to the end customer on a Deliver Duty Paid (DPP) basis.
